Primary Causes of Tesla Heater Not Working
Several factors can lead to your Tesla heater malfunctioning, especially in cold weather. These range from physical hardware limitations to software glitches and battery constraints. Understanding these causes helps you identify the right fixes and maintain comfort during your drive.
Heat Pump System Limitations
Tesla’s heater relies heavily on a heat pump that transfers heat from the outside air, battery, and motor components to warm the cabin. In extremely cold conditions, below freezing temperatures reduce the heat available in the outside air.
This limits the heat pump’s ability to generate enough warmth efficiently. To compensate, the heat pump runs longer and uses more power, which can still leave your cabin feeling colder than expected.
Pre-conditioning your Tesla while it’s plugged in significantly improves heating performance by warming the battery and interior before driving. Parking in a sheltered or heated garage also helps by preventing the vehicle from becoming too cold overnight. These steps reduce strain on the heat pump and improve comfort in low temperatures.
Firmware and Software Issues
Tesla continuously updates its systems to address heater performance, but some firmware versions have caused heater malfunctions. Certain builds between 2021 and early 2022 involved recalls related to the heat pump’s Electronic Expansion Valve firmware.
Software bugs can cause the heater to respond erratically or show error messages. While waiting for official updates, you can try these mitigations:
- Set climate control to Auto for optimal heating adjustments.
- Enable recirculate mode to keep warm air inside your cabin and conserve energy.
- Reboot your Tesla by holding both steering scroll wheels to clear glitches.
Monitoring and installing the latest updates via your touchscreen or Tesla app ensures your heater runs on the most stable firmware.
Low Battery Level
Your Tesla’s heater draws power from the main battery through the heat pump system. If the battery charge drops too low, the heater may stop working or operate at reduced capacity to conserve energy.
To avoid heater issues, keep your battery charged to at least 50% before driving in cold weather. Using faster charging options like Superchargers helps you quickly restore sufficient power.
Low battery conditions not only affect heating but also overall vehicle range and performance during winter. Charging habits, therefore, directly impact your heating reliability and driving safety.
Blower Motor and Resistor Failures
In some cases, the heater’s blower motor or associated resistors can fail, resulting in either no airflow or inconsistent heating inside the cabin. Mechanical wear, electrical faults, or fuse issues may cause these components to stop working.
You can check for blown fuses or error codes displayed on your touchscreen. Diagnosing blower or resistor failures typically requires a service appointment.
If faulty, the blower motor or resistor must be repaired or replaced to restore adequate cab heating. Tesla’s warranty generally covers such hardware repairs, but timely troubleshooting ensures you don’t face heating problems during critical cold weather.

Troubleshooting Steps for a Malfunctioning Tesla Heater
When your Tesla heater isn’t working properly, focusing on the vehicle’s software, climate control settings, and system reboot can often resolve the issue. These targeted steps address common problems linked to Tesla’s heating system, particularly in cold conditions where heater performance can be limited.
Check for Software Updates
Tesla frequently releases software updates that improve heater functionality, especially related to the heat pump system. Your heater may malfunction due to outdated firmware or unresolved bugs.
To check for updates, access the Tesla touchscreen menu or use the Tesla app on your phone. If an update is available, schedule or initiate installation promptly. These updates can enhance heat pump efficiency and fix known heater glitches.
Keeping your vehicle software current ensures you benefit from performance improvements and potential bug fixes impacting your Tesla heater.
Inspect Climate and Recirculation Settings
Your Tesla’s climate control settings directly impact heating efficiency. Set the climate control to Auto mode to allow the system to automatically adjust fan speed, airflow direction, and temperature based on your preferences and outside conditions.
Using recirculation mode helps retain the already heated air inside the cabin, reducing cold air entry and conserving energy. This is particularly effective in very cold weather.
Verify these settings through the touchscreen; incorrect or manual settings often lead to insufficient heat.
Hard Rebooting the Tesla System
A system reboot can clear temporary glitches affecting your heater. To perform a hard reboot, hold down both scroll wheels on the steering wheel until the touchscreen turns black.
This action resets the onboard computer without erasing your preferences or data. After rebooting, observe if the heater starts operating normally.
If problems persist, this step may need to be combined with software updates or a service appointment. Hard rebooting is a quick first step before more complex troubleshooting.

Maintenance Tips and Prevention for Tesla Heater Issues
Proper care can minimize Tesla heater not working problems and enhance your vehicle’s heating performance. Focusing on preconditioning, parking, and system checks helps maintain consistent cabin warmth and reduces strain on your heater components.
Preconditioning Your Vehicle
Preconditioning your Tesla while it’s plugged in warms both the battery and the cabin before you start driving. You should activate this via the mobile app or the car’s touchscreen 30 to 60 minutes prior to departure. This process helps reduce energy consumption during your drive and ensures the heater operates efficiently from the start.
Frequent preconditioning in cold weather prevents the heat pump system from struggling to extract heat from freezing temperatures. It also maintains battery health, reducing range loss caused by low temperatures. Remember, preconditioning only works when your vehicle is connected to a power source, so plan accordingly.
Optimal Parking Practices
Where you park your Tesla influences heater performance. Parking in a garage or under a shelter helps keep the cabin and battery temperature higher overnight or during extended stops. This reduces the chance of your heater failing to produce enough warmth in cold conditions.
Avoid leaving your Tesla exposed to extreme cold for long periods. Exposure increases the workload on the heater and heat pump system to maintain a comfortable cabin temperature. Using a car cover or a heated garage can preserve battery life and improve overall system reliability.
Routine System Checks
Regularly inspecting your Tesla’s HVAC system helps catch heater-related issues early. Start by verifying climate settings: use Auto mode with recirculating air enabled to optimize heating efficiency and reduce cold air intake.
If you notice inconsistent heating or receive error messages, perform a simple reboot by holding both steering wheel scroll wheels until the screen resets. This clears minor software glitches affecting the heater system.
Finally, pay attention to software updates and recalls from Tesla. Some heater problems arise from firmware or hardware faults, which may require professional diagnostics or component replacement if routine checks don’t resolve the problem.

When to Seek Professional Service for Tesla Heater Problems
If your Tesla heater remains unresponsive despite basic troubleshooting, it’s essential to identify when professional help is required. Certain issues, especially those related to hardware failure or software bugs, may need diagnostic tools and repairs beyond your capacity. Understanding warranty coverage and anticipating repair costs can also guide your decision.
Recognizing Severe Hardware Failures
You should consider professional service if the heater issue stems from physical component failure. Common hardware problems include a faulty heat pump, blower motor malfunction, or a damaged PTC heater element. Symptoms such as no warm air output, unusual noises, or system errors on your display suggest hardware faults.
These issues often cannot be resolved with software resets or climate control adjustments. Attempting DIY fixes on critical parts could worsen the problem. A certified technician uses diagnostic tools to pinpoint the exact failure and provide a safe, reliable repair or replacement.
Warranty and Recall Considerations
Check if your Tesla is still under warranty or subject to any recalls related to the heating system. Tesla issued a recall in early 2022 for over 26,000 vehicles due to heat pump defects. If your model and year fall within this recall, professional repairs may be covered at no charge.
Your vehicle’s limited or extended warranty could also cover heater components, reducing repair costs. Always verify coverage before scheduling service. You can confirm recalls and warranty status through Tesla’s official channels or the mobile app.
Cost Expectations for Repairs
Heater repairs can vary widely in cost depending on the model and nature of the fault. For example, replacing a PTC heater or heat pump assembly can range from several hundred to over a thousand dollars. Labor and parts prices influence the total.
If out of warranty, you should prepare for substantial expenses. Tesla sometimes offers loaner vehicles during extended repair periods, which can be helpful if you rely heavily on your car. Request a detailed estimate before authorizing any work to avoid surprises. Details on repair costs and owner experiences can be found in community forums and service reports.
